A love of reading inspires creativity, improves employment opportunities, mental … Web15 Aug 2024 · Scottish Book Trust is a national charity that believes books, reading and writing have the power to change lives. A love of reading inspires creativity, improves employment opportunities, mental health and wellbeing and is one of the most effective ways to help break the poverty cycle.

WebThe Bookbug book gifting programme gives every child four free packs of books between birth and primary 1, without any need to register.
